“Comfortably Numb: How Psychiatry Is Medicating a Nation” by Charles Barber is an intricately structured analysis of the modern scenario involving psychiatric medication in the United States. Setting a balance between personal anecdotes, scholarly research, and detailed critical analysis of the system, Barber (2009) illuminates fields that enabled the delivery of psychiatric drugs in massive quantities. This paper aims to scrutinize Barber's work and identify its strengths, and weaknesses.
The personal narrative and academic rigor Barber combined in his storyline keeps the reader hooked throughout (Barber, 2015). As a practicing psychotherapist and a faculty member of Yale University, Barber presents an insightful voice in the discussion on his grounded understanding informed by first-hand interactions with patients. The work is arranged structurally, each chapter sheds light on various aspects of the phenomenon very much seen while talking about psychiatric medicine. Barber investigates the evolution of psychiatric therapy, the pharmaceutical industry expansion, and its rise to power through marketing techniques influencing prescription practice as well as the influence that medication has on different populations for example children and veterans.
Barber’s style of writing is scholarly, yet his work can be easily understood by the masses as he demystifies complex concepts. He implements empirical research to encourage his statements effectively. The discussion about the treatment of mental health through vivid storytelling and strong arguments made by Barber humanizes it (Barber, 2015), revealing what people suffer in their lives from those kinds of psychiatric medications.
